Rodauth before 2.47.0 fails to validate protocol-relative return-to paths in confirm_password, login_return_to_requested_location, and two_factor_auth_return_to_requested_location features. Attackers can craft paths with leading double slashes that browsers resolve as protocol-relative URLs, redirecting authenticated users to attacker-controlled sites after login or password confirmation.
